Yuta Tanaka is a scholar working on Organic Chemistry, Molecular Biology and Oncology. According to data from OpenAlex, Yuta Tanaka has authored 51 papers receiving a total of 764 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Organic Chemistry, 13 papers in Molecular Biology and 8 papers in Oncology. Recurrent topics in Yuta Tanaka's work include Synthesis of Indole Derivatives (4 papers), Liver Diseases and Immunity (3 papers) and Radical Photochemical Reactions (3 papers). Yuta Tanaka is often cited by papers focused on Synthesis of Indole Derivatives (4 papers), Liver Diseases and Immunity (3 papers) and Radical Photochemical Reactions (3 papers). Yuta Tanaka collaborates with scholars based in Japan, United States and Taiwan. Yuta Tanaka's co-authors include Motomu Kanai, Masakatsu Shibasaki, Takeshi Oishi, Keisuke Fukaya, Takaaki Sato, Noritaka Chida, Ikuo Miyahisa, Tomohiro Kawamoto, Takaharu Mizutani and Yasuhiro Imaeda and has published in prestigious journals such as Journal of the American Chemical Society, Biochemical and Biophysical Research Communications and Journal of Medicinal Chemistry.
